| Criteria | Edge | Why |
|---|---|---|
| Specificity | Quit a Vice | Quitting a vice is often clearly defined, whether it's smoking, drinking, or another specific habit. |
| Measurability | Quit a Vice | Progress in quitting a vice can be quantitatively tracked, such as counting days without engaging in the vice. |
| Achievability | Quality Time | Spending quality time is generally more achievable as it requires less drastic lifestyle changes than quitting a vice. |
| Relevance | Quality Time | Quality time aligns more universally with personal values and long-term relationships, enhancing life satisfaction. |
